Hi, my given name is Ricky Primrose.  I came into foster care on February 9, 2021.  It was a wonderful day for me because I got to joyfully join a fostering pack of five in a dog loving home.  When I came in my tail was wagging like crazy!  The moment I came in the door I knew I was going to be taken care of and I had new friends.  I had been someone’s dog it was obvious and even though I had lost my family I knew how to be a pet.  I warmed up right away to regular meals and my fragile skinny body responded quickly.  My dark coat began to shine, and my eyes got bright and happy.  I knew I was one of the lucky dogs that would be going to a forever home.  I was grateful for a warm place during the winter storm and I showed it with lots of cuddles.  My favorite thing is to hang with my foster mom in the art studio.  There are lots of windows and I could perch on the back of a sofa and look out at the birds.  I was not used to being in a crate and it caused me a great deal of distress but a bed near my humans at night worked nicely.  I learned quickly from my pack buddies the routines they followed.  I was smart and could sit for my meals and take turns when treats were given out. Everyone goes out as a group here for potty breaks and I learned it quickly also using a doggie door.  I did not have to worry about anything, and I relaxed.  At night I sit with my foster mom in a recliner by her legs on a warm blanket and I am hoping wherever I end up in a permanent situation I can have the same.  I have not been tested with cats or small children, so I am hoping an older couple might want me for my gentle loving nature and delicate lite frame.  I am small and long so a delicate handler would be best for me.  My foster mom is working with me to understand I am safe in an exercise pen if needed but really, I am so good in the house it is not necessary. I am a particularly good, well behaved young man.  I have a soft voice and don’t bark a lot.  I have a ton of love to share so if you are looking for something to add some joy to these days...
